KOWLOON CITY FIRE

OUTBREAK IN JOSS

PAPER STORE

A fire broke out at No. 13 Shape Street, Kowloon Cis, at 2.15 this morning, resulting in the total floor, destruction of the ground used for the storage of joss-paper, The fire spread to the first and second floors, but these were saved from being gutted by the of the Fire exculiont work Brigade.

No casualties were suffered, and the extent of the damage has not- yet been estimated.

DIPLOMATS' VIEW

RUSSO-JAPAN POSITION NOT SO ALARMING

Dairen, Sept. 10. Mr. II. Saito, whose termin office as Ambassador to Washing- ton earned him a high reputation. and Mr. N. Sato, equally well. known as Minister Plenipotentiary at Geneva, arrived in Dairen this morning, in the course of a Man- chukus tour.

Interviewed to-day they asserted elements in that responsible America and France were gradual- ly beginning to consider Manchukuo and unemo- questions rationally tionally, in view of the improved prospects for investment.

The future, they agree, depends upon how effectively Changchun maintains the "Upen Door Policy," equal opportunity for a nations and law and order within the state. Commenting on the recent Soviet the frontier. demonstrations on

hoth declared it was best for Japan and Manchukuo to keep cool leads in order to surmount the present difficulties, which, actually,

not so alarming-Reuter..

Visiting Nanking.

were

Shanghai, Sept. 10.

Mr. Ariyoshi, Japanese Minis- ter, left for Nanking to-night where he will hold Important conversations with Chinese gov ernment members, it is expected, regarding Sino-Japanese relations. -Router.
